RO's usually like higher pressure but they usually have maximum pressure rating on the components. Ideally match the feed pressure to the RO to its maximum rating and then pressure reduce the non RO uses to the rest of the house.
 
BTW, I have triple filter system installed but not piped for my house. Its own my long "projects" list. Its triple filter using standards 20" filters. Something like this LiquaGen B00MTTHYBI Blue TRIPLE BIG 20'' WATER SYSTEM-1" Sediment/Carbon/GAC Filters, 4.5&quot x 20&quot

The goal is to put a sediment filter at the front to get the big stuff than a GAC (granulated activated carbon) filter in the middle and then a final GAC filter on the end. By going with standard filters bodies there are multiple suppliers to buy replacements from . In theory the sediment filter gets changed as needed more often and then the middle GAC gets changed less frequently by moving the final filter to its position while the end GAC filter gets swapped for a new filter. Note that on homes with radon in the water the GAC filter can get slightly radioactive so best to dispose of it rather than keeping them around the house. Commercial outfits are supposed to dispose of it as special waste. Definitely a bad idea to burn it in the stove.

Big filters have lower pressure drops than smaller filters and GAC works better with low flow. They cost more for the housings and filters but the filters last longer.

Inherently GAC is pretty well known. A gravity filter is as good as bad as the depth of the filter media. Unlike a pressurized filter, the velocity is low and the pressure doesnt tend to "rat hole" the product. With that in mind as long as Berkey uses quality media it should work

On occasion I deal with boiler feedwater for superheated steam fed to steam turbines. Power plants go with what works and skip the hype. The water has to be super pure as any impurities foul up the clearances of the blades. Generally the systems use sediment filters up ahead of deep bed ion exchange resins. Newer systems use reverse osmosis as they cost less to install and maintain. I dont see activated carbon in any of the systems. I have looked at electrodeionization (EDI) systems in the past which seem to be the best technology for raw water but its not a good fit for an operation that recycles its condensate as the EDI membranes will not hold up to heat. Some of the RO tehnologies have the same issue. Usually there is ion exchange system on the return condensate as it designed for heat.

I did have a chance in my career to work on a system designed by Eastman Kodak in the 1880s to treat water to remove dissolved color from the water to make photo graphic paper whihc had to be ultra white, it used deep gravity beds of crushed coal ( a precursor to activated carbon). The plant is still running after 140 years although the current owner does a poor job maintaining it. GAC and crushed coal both have only limited capacity to absorb contaminants so generally conductivity testing is used to confirm that the systems are operating correctly.

The water treatment provided by a GAC system like the Berkey is not the same as that of RO. GAC works on the basis of adsorption while RO relies on osmosis (transfer though a semi-permeable membrane). While GAC is good at removing contaminants like chlorine or organic compounds its not good at removing metals or dissolved solids like salts and other minerals like calcium and magnesium (i.e., hardness).
